Whoa. If this news from @Podnews is correct, Anchor's valuation multiple was much lower than Gimlet's:

Anchor
- $14.4M in funding
- Acquired for $50M
- Multiple: 3.5x

Gimlet
- $28.5M in funding
- Acquired for $250M
- Multiple: 9x

🤔 Usually valuations are = Software > Content.

@_danielmeade Total podcasting economy is probably bigger than $500M, but...

Total ad rev for podcasts was only $314 million in 2017.

In 2015, Midroll Media was acquired for $50 million.

In 2018, Stuff Media (How Stuff Works) was acquired for $55 million.

This Spotify deal could also increase the total number of podcast listeners.

Currently, only about 48 million 🇺🇸 residents listen to podcasts weekly.

Spotify has 87 million paying subscribers, and 191 million active users.

The more I think about it, the more insane this Spotify news is:

- Acquired Gimlet for $230M
- Acquired Anchor for $?
- Going to spend up to $500M on acquisitions this year

First, Gimlet was valued at $70M before this deal. Spotify paid $160M more than that.
